Description
David Carr Glover and Dick Averre arrangements. Use in sequence for those just learning, or out of sequence for the experienced player. Contents include: Angels We Have Heard on High * Deck the Halls * It Came Upon a Midnight Clear * Jolly Old St. Nicholas * The Holly and the Ivy * We Three Kings of Orient Are and more.

How to get the most out of it

  • Pedal thoughtfully through the sustained harmonies in 'Angels We Have Heard on High' to build resonance without muddying the melody line.
  • Shape the left hand accompaniment in the livelier pieces like 'Jolly Old St. Nicholas' so it supports rather than overshadows the right hand melody.
  • Take time with tempo choices in the slower carols; letting these pieces breathe gives students room to sing through the phrases.
